Identification
Bold, glossy-black bird with a very long and deeply forked tail and a red eye. An uncommon species that is confined to the island of Mayotte in the Comoros. Found locally in remnant rainforest, secondary forest, plantations, and mangroves. Perches prominently on open perches, swooping out to catch insects on the wing. Song is a liquid sequence of whistles, creaks, and rasps, often given as a duet.
